Drug Rehabilitation and Detox for Withdrawal Symptoms

One of the reasons drug addicted individuals find it extremely hard to stop using drugs once they start using them, is because of physical and psychological dependency that inevitably occurs if the person uses them long enough. It no longer becomes a matter of "willpower" because their bodies and minds will actually produce extremely uncomfortable withdrawal symptoms if they stop using drugs. This is called drug withdrawal, and is a major barrier for people who wish to stop using drugs. Addicts will become very ill during withdrawal and can even die in in some cases, as seizures and strokes can occur with certain drugs and with alcohol. Depression is a very common withdrawal symptom, which can become so severe that the person may commit suicide.

To ease certain withdrawal symptoms and to make detoxification a safer process, it is important that addicts who wish to quit do so in a suitable atmosphere such as a drug rehab program. Drug Addiction and the Enabler

It is not uncommon in most cases of addiction in Grosse Pointe Woods that the persons habit is influenced fully or in part by a person in their immediate environment. An enabler is either a knowing or unknowing participant in the individuals struggle with drug addiction, and is someone who makes their addiction possible or less difficult to continue on. The act of enabling is typically done out of "concern" or "worry", but does more damage than good in the end. A good example of an enabler is a family member or partner who provides a drug addicted individual any kind of financing, housing, and may even help the person to get their drugs in some way. The logic behind this is often that the enabling is keeping the individual in a safe and secure scenario, instead of being on the streets or in harmful situations.

Enablers are frequently the crucial component in an addicted persons life which is actually making the drug addiction possible. Reversely, enablers can also be the key to helping someone get off of drugs by discontinuing the enabling behaviors. As soon as the enabling has been stopped, drug addicted individuals will often find that it is no longer possible to continue their habit and will reach a crisis point. Drug Overdose in Grosse Pointe Woods

A drug overdose in reference to doctor prescribed drugs occurs when an individual takes more than the medically recommended dose of the medication. A drug overdose relating to illicit drugs that are used to get high happens when a person's body cannot metabolize the drug rapidly enough to avoid damaging side effects. An individual experiencing a drug overdose in Grosse Pointe Woods may have several physically noticeable signs that should be taken very seriously.

Drug Overdose Symptoms:

  • problems with vital signs (temperature, blood pressure, heart rate) are possible in a drug overdose and can be life threatening. Vital signs in the case of drug overdoses can be increased, decreased, or completely absent.
  • Sleepiness, confusion, and coma are very typical drug overdose symptoms and can be very dangerous if the person breathes vomit into the lungs (aspirated).
  • When an individual is having a drug overdose, their skin may be sweaty and cold, or it could be hot and dry.
  • There is a possibility that a person experiencing a drug overdose will experience chest pain or their breathing may become rapid, slow, deep, or shallow.
  • Abdominal pain, nausea, vomiting, and diarrhea are also common in a drug overdose. Vomiting blood, or blood in the stool caused by a drug overdose can be life threatening.
  • Some drugs can damage certain organs like the kidneys, heart or lungs in the case of a drug overdose.

Always take appropriate caution when handling a drug overdose. Medical treatment in Grosse Pointe Woods will be dictated by the particular drug taken in the overdose. Information that can be provided about the quantity of the drug taken and the time that the drug was taken, and any existing medical conditions that the individual in Grosse Pointe Woods is exhibiting can be very helpful to medical staff treating a particular person that is experiencing a drug overdose.

  • Drug Overdose Facts
  • Among high school seniors in the U.S., past-year nonmedical use of Adderall and over-the-counter cough and cold medicines remains high at 6.5% and 6.6%, respectively.
  • Crystal meth puts the body in "overdrive", ready for fight or flight syndrome, increased pulse, blood pressure, respiration, and temp., and dilate pupils.
  • Ecstasy first became popular in the "rave" and all-night party scene, although use has now spread to a wide range of settings and demographic subgroups.
  • Because the sale of GHB is illegal, no controls are in place regarding strength and purity of the drug when it is produced.
  • Ecstasy use can cause nausea which could lead to vomiting which greatly increases the risk of death and other health consequences in the event that an unconscious Ecstasy user accidentally suffocates on their own vomit.
